Rebel NCP MP Amol Kolhe Returns To Sharad Pawar's Camp
In a first blow to rebel Ajit Pawar, Nationalist Congress Party (NCP) MP Amol Kolhe extended support to Sharad Pawar, a day after joining the Eknath Shinde-led Maharashtra government.
"When there is a war between mind and heart, listen to your heart. Perhaps the mind sometimes forgets morality... but the heart never...I'm with Saheb," Kolhe tweeted on Monday.

NCP chief Sharad Pawar said several MLAs from Ajit Pawar's camp have contacted him stating that their ideology is similar to the party's.
"Many from there (Ajit Pawar) camp called me and said that their ideology is not different from that of NCP and they will take a final call in the next few days," he said.
On Sunday, Ajit Pawar led a vertical split in the NCP to become the deputy chief minister. Eight other NCP leaders were also sworn in as ministers in the Eknath Shinde-BJP government.
While Ajit was sworn in as Deputy CM, eight other heavyweights of NCP were also sworn in as ministers, who have been close aides to his uncle and NCP President Sharad Pawar. These leaders include Chhagan Bhujbal, Dilip Walse-Patil, Hasan Musharif, Dhananjay Mundhe, and Aditi Tatkare. Ajit claims to have the support of 43 of the 53 NCP MLAs.
Ajit is now the second Deputy CM of Maharashtra, with Devendra Fadnavis of the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) being the other.
This is the second tripartite government in Maharashtra, with the BJP, Shinde's Shiv Sena faction, and the NCP sharing governance. The first was formed in 2019 when Sharad Pawar stitched the coalition of the unified Sena, Congress, and NCP. It was known was the Maha Vikas Aghadi (MVA) coalition.
In 2022, Shinde's rebellion against the then-CM Uddhav Thackeray brought down the MVA government. Aided by the BJP, Shinde defected with 40 of the 57 Shiv Sena MLAs and eight of the 13 MPs to form government with the BJP.
A year later, Ajit has followed in Shinde's footsteps and effected a split in the NCP by defecting with 43 MLAs of the party. This is the third time since the Assembly elections of 2019 that he has taken charge as the Deputy Chief Minister.
